5 Free Keyword Finders For Beginning Internet Marketers

By Don Lawson

If you're not using keyword tools to find profitable keywords, you're leaving money on the table. Keyword tools allow you to find phrases that people are using to search the Internet. The right keywords can actually be more profitable than your main keyword. Finding these money making words is easy once you start using the right tools.

A beginning Internet Marketer can save their self quite a bit of money by using one of the many free keyword tools available to them. Some of the paid versions can cost you fifty bucks or month or more. Others have a one time fee of several hundred dollars. Lucky for us frugal marketers, the free versions are good choices for finding those money making niches.

These five keyword tools are free to use and powerful enough for anyone to find those hot niches.

One tool you'll want to learn how to use is Google's keyword tool. This free keyword tool will show you the approximate number of searches in the past month and the avereage number of searches per month over the last year. You can also see the approximate per click rate advertisers are paying for your keyword.

SEO Book has a great keyword research tool that I use. In fact, out of these 5 tools, it's probably the best out there. This tool will show you many variables on each keyword. For example, it will show you the estimated clicks per day from all the major search engines, the Compete Rank, Google Trends and many more. You can really drill down to find those profitable keywords with this tool.

The next keyword tool has been around a long time. It's been a favorite of many marketers. A lot of them go on to buy the full version, but for the beginner, the free version is powerful enough. It's called WordTracker. WordTracker's free version allows users to sort and drill down through long tail keywords in order to find ones that will be profitable.

Good Keywords is a free program you can download to your desktop or laptop. One feature I really love about this program is its ability to find misspellings. Misspellings can really make you a lot of money. For example, many people go to a search engine and type in 'low fat deserts' instead of low fat desserts. Misspellings have been used by smart Internet Marketers to make loads of money over the years.

If you really want to expand your keyword base, then WordPot is a free keyword tool you should give a try. This tool has many features, including the ability to find synonyms and other related keywords. By including alternate keywords or words related to your keyword, you can add substantial amounts of money to your bottom line.
